Ube Crinkles
Ube Crinkles with cream cheese filling are amazingly delicious! With a crunch of a cookie outside and fudgy inside. Made more tasty with creamy cream cheese frosting!
Prep Time10 minutes mins
Cook Time10 minutes mins
Resting Time30 minutes mins
Course: Dessert, Snack
Cuisine: International
Keyword: ube crinkles, ube crinkles recipe
Servings: 12 pieces
Calories:
Author: Mia
Crinkle cookies
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- ½ tsp baking powder
- ¼ tsp salt
- ½ cup granulated white sugar
- ⅛ cup vegetable oil
- 2 tsp ube flavoring
- 1 medium egg
Cream cheese frosting
- ½ cup cream cheese
- ¼ cup butter
- ¼ cup powdered sugar
In a mixing bowl sift the dry ingredients (flour, baking powder, and salt) then set aside.
½ tsp baking powder, ¼ tsp salt
In a different bowl add the egg, sugar, vegetable oil, and ube flavoring. Whisk until completely incorporated.
½ cup granulated white sugar, ⅛ cup vegetable oil, 2 tsp ube flavoring, 1 medium egg
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ients. Carefully fold with a rubber spatula until there are no more traces of flour. NOTE: Don’t mix too much or else your cookie will come out hard.
Chill the dough for at least 30 minutes or overnight in the refrigerator. While resting the batter you can make the cream cheese filling.
Making the cream cheese filling
In a bowl, place the softened butter then whisks until creamy and light in color. Add the cream cheese then whisk again until fluffy. Tip in the powder sugar gradually while whisking until well incorporated. Transfer in a piping bag and set aside.
½ cup cream cheese, ¼ cup butter, ¼ cup powdered sugar
Making the red velvet crinkles
Prepare baking sheets with parchment paper lining. Preheat oven at 180°C or 350°F
Remove dough from the refrigerator and prepare powdered sugar in a bowl.
Scoop dough with ice cream scoop or oiled hands, shape into medium balls (approximately 1-2 tbsp).
Roll cookie dough balls into powdered sugar and evenly coat. Transfer to the parchment paper-lined baking sheets, then bake in preheated oven 9 – 10 minutes.
½ cup powdered sugar
Allow resting on cookie sheet for several minutes then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ely. When cool to touch, spread cream cheese frosting on one cookie and top with another. Bon appetit!
